You can find an input, at least one particular concealed layer of nodes and an output. Every node applies a operate and when the weight crosses its specified threshold, the info is transmitted to another layer. A community is usually referred to as a deep neural network if it's a minimum of 2 concealed layers.[a hundred and five]

Supervised machine learning styles are experienced with labeled info sets, which permit the products to learn and mature additional accurate as time passes. One example is, an algorithm could be skilled with pics of canine and various factors, all labeled by humans, as well as the machine would find out methods to identify pictures of canine on its own. Supervised machine learning is the most typical variety employed currently.

When the feminine wasp returns to her burrow with food items, she first deposits it on the threshold, checks for thieves inside her burrow, and only then, In case the coast is clear, carries her food inside. The real nature in the wasp’s instinctual behaviour is exposed In case the food stuff is moved a couple of inches from the entrance to her burrow whilst she is inside of: on rising, she will repeat The entire technique as generally as being the food is displaced. Gradient descent is a sort of area lookup that optimizes a set of numerical parameters by incrementally adjusting them to attenuate a decline function. Variants of gradient descent are generally utilized to train neural networks.[77]
